Welcoming House Guests
Having company over can be wonderful, but it also takes a little planning to ensure everyone feels relaxed. First and foremost, chat with your guests about their needs and preferences. Do they have any food sensitivities? Are they morning people? Knowing this in advance will help you plan accordingly.
Provide your guests a personal space where they can relax and unwind. This could be a guest room, a cozy corner in the living room, or even a hammock on the porch! Make sure they have access to essential amenities like fresh towels, cozy bedding, and a place to tuck away their belongings.
Consider adding some thoughtful gestures to make your guests feel valued. A welcome basket filled with snacks and drinks, a handwritten note, or a small present can go a long way in showing your friendliness.
Plan some fun activities for your guests to enjoy, but also be sure to acknowledge their need for alone time. A mix of social events and downtime will help create a balanced experience for everyone. Finally, remember that the most important thing is to stay true to you and enjoy the company of your guests!

Hitting the road on a Budget: Smart Savings Tips
Planning a getaway without breaking the bank can feel like a challenge. But don't worry! With a little planning, you can find affordable lodging.
Begin your search early to secure the best offers. Consider traveling during the shoulder season when rates are often lower.
Explore for hotels that offer free amenities like morning eats, Wi-Fi, and parking.
Don't be afraid to explore staying in a less popular location. You might find great value just outside the main tourist district.
Keep in mind that membership programs and rewards programs can often lead to exclusive offers. Finally, be open with your travel dates as prices can fluctuate depending on the day of the week or time of year.
By following these tips, you can enjoy a comfortable and memorable hotel stay without wasting.
